The Rise of Live Dealer Games
A significant development in recent years has been the emergence of live dealer games. These games bridge the gap between the convenience of online casinos and the immersive experience of a brick-and-mortar establishment. Players interact with real dealers via live video streams, adding a social element and a greater sense of authenticity to the online gaming experience. Typically, live dealer games include variations of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ker, and they often feature higher betting limits and a more sophisticated atmosphere. This format has proven particularly popular among players who miss the social interaction and the visual cues that are inherent in traditional casino settings. | Game | House Edge (Approximate) | Skill Level |
|---|---|---|
| Slot Machines | 2% – 15% | Low |
| Blackjack (Basic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| Medium-High |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low-Medium |
| Poker (Texas Hold'em) | Variable (Player vs. Player) | High |
Understanding the house edge – the statistical advantage held by the casino – is crucial for informed decision-making. While it's impossible to eliminate the house edge entirely, players can minimize its impact by selecting games with lower edges and employing strategies to improve their odds. Table games, especially those requiring skill and strategy like blackjack and poker, offer greater potential for player control and can significantly reduce the house advantage.

Setting Limits and Self-Exclusion
Modern casinos, both online and brick-and-mortar, are increasingly implementing features to promote responsible gaming. These include de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ion programs. De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it into their account within a specified timeframe, while loss limits cap the amount of money they can lose. Self-exclusion programs allow individuals to voluntarily ban themselves from accessing casino services for a predetermined period, providing a much-needed break and a chance to regain control. These tools empower players to manage their gambling behavior and protect themselves from potential harm. Proactive management of funds is essential.

Strategies for Different Casino Games
While luck plays a significant role in many casino games, employing sound strategies can significantly improve a player’s odds. In blackjack, mastering basic strategy – a mathematically derived set of rules that dictates the optimal play for every possible hand combination – can reduce the house edge to less than 1%. In poker, understanding hand rankings, reading opponents, and managing bankroll are essential skills. For slot machines, where outcomes are primarily random, strategies focus on selecting machines with favorable paytables and understanding the mechanics of bonus rounds. However, these strategies are not guarantees of success, only tools to play with better odds. Thorough research and practice are essential for maximizing the effectiveness of any gaming strategy. Exploring the World of Casino Bonuses and Promotions
Casinos frequently offer a variety of b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can range from welcome bonuses, which provide a match on your initial deposit, to free spins, loyalty programs, and special events. While bonuses can be a valuable way to boost your bankroll, it’s important to understand the associated terms and conditions. These often include wagering requirements, which specify the amount you must bet before you can withdraw any winnings. Carefully reviewing these terms is crucial to avoid disappointment and ensure you’re getting the best possible value from the offer.
